Definitions
- the present invention relates to a sheet-like member cutter that cuts a sheet-like member with a reciprocating cutter.
- a sheet-like member cutter is used that cuts a planar member that is sheet-like or tape-like and is not so thick.
- patent document 1 is mentioned, for example.
- the sheet-like member cutter 100 includes a movable blade 10 and a fixed blade 12 as shown in FIG.
- the moving blade 10 is attached to the moving base 14 so as to be inclined with respect to the blade edge 12a of the fixed blade 12 so that the cutting start side of the blade edge 10a is closer to the fixed blade 12 than the cutting end side.
- the movable blade 10 is provided with a support shaft 10b protruding from both sides thereof.
- the moving blade 10 is held rotatably with respect to the moving base 14 about the support shaft 10b.
- a spring that urges the movable blade 10 toward the fixed blade 12 so that the cutting start side of the blade edge 10 a of the movable blade 10 is pressed against a guide portion 12 b that protrudes upward from the end of the fixed blade 12. 16 is provided on the moving base 14.
- a spring 16 is provided as shown in the partially enlarged side view of FIG. 6 or the partially enlarged side view of FIG. As shown in the figure, a structure is adopted in which the moving blade 10 is fixed to the moving base 14 by a leaf spring 18.
- an object of the present invention is to provide a sheet-like member cutter that makes it possible to cut a sheet-like member with a simpler structure than before.
- One aspect of the present invention is that the movable blade and the fixed blade, which are arranged so as to face each other so that the blade edge of one of the blades is inclined with respect to the blade edge of the other blade, and the movable blade is fixed, And a moving base that moves relative to the fixed blade, and the moving blade is pressed against the fixed blade by an elastic force along a short side direction, and is moved against the fixed blade by the moving base.
- the sheet-like member cutter is characterized by shearing the sheet-like member placed between the fixed blade and the fixed blade.
- the movable blade is fixed to the movable base over the long side direction.
- the thickness of the movable blade is preferably 0.1 mm or more and 1 mm or less.
- the sheet-like member cutter 200 in the embodiment of the present invention includes a moving blade 30, a fixed blade 32, a moving blade fixing portion 34, a moving base 36, A fixed blade fixing portion 38, a fixed base 40, and an elastic member 42 are included.
- the moving blade 30 is a substantially strip-shaped plate-like elastic member having a long side and a short side.
- the moving blade 30 is fixed to the moving blade fixing portion 34 along the upper side (the other of the long sides) with the lower side (one of the long sides) as the cutting edge 30a.
- the blade edge 30a is fixed so as to protrude from the movable blade fixing portion 34 to the fixed blade 32 side.
- the material constituting the moving blade 30 has elasticity along at least the short side direction.
- it can be set as the plate-shaped member which made the metal strip shape.
- the moving blade 30 can be made of stainless steel or a very inexpensive hardened steel strip.
- the thickness of the moving blade 30 is preferably 0.1 mm or more and 1.0 mm or less in order to give elasticity in the short side direction.
- it is preferable that the length of the long side of the moving blade 30 is slightly longer than the necessary cutting width.
- the short one can be 10 mm and the long one can be 3000 mm. What is necessary is just to determine the length of a short side in the range which can give elasticity.
- about 0.5 mm is preferable when the thickness is 0.5 mm, and about 80 mm is preferable when the thickness is 1 mm. By using this dimension, the elasticity of the moving blade 30 in the short side direction can be efficiently used.
- the moving blade fixing portion 34 supports the lower side (one of the long sides) of the moving blade 30 so as not to bend along the long side direction.
- the moving blade fixing part 34 is fixed to the moving base 36.
- the moving base 36 is a member for moving the moving blade 30 toward the fixed blade 32, and is attached to the fixed base 40 via the elastic member 42.
- the elastic member 42 can be a member such as a spring, for example.
- the moving base 36 also functions as a gripping part for pressing the moving blade 30 toward the fixed blade 32 without the user directly touching the moving blade 30. In order to smoothly perform the relative movement between the moving base 36 and the fixed base 40, it is also preferable to provide a guide means or the like for defining the moving direction.
- the fixed blade 32 is a substantially strip-shaped plate-shaped member having a long side and a short side.
- the fixed blade 32 is a member for shearing the sheet-like member W placed between the fixed blade 32 and the movable blade 30 when the blade edge 30a of the movable blade 30 is pressed against the blade edge 32a.
- the fixed blade 32 is fixed by laying on the upper portion of the fixed blade fixing portion 38 along the other long side (the front side of the drawing in FIG. 1) with one of the long sides (the back side of the drawing in FIG. 1) as the cutting edge 32a. .
- the blade edge 32 a is fixed so as to protrude from the fixed blade fixing portion 38 to the moving blade 30 side (the back side in FIG. 1).
- the material constituting the fixed blade 32 only needs to be rigidly attached to the fixed blade fixing portion 38, and can be a thin elastic plate-like member.
- the fixed blade 32 can be composed of hard stainless steel or an inexpensive hardened steel strip.
- a rigid member may be used.
- it may be composed of hardened steel.
- the cutting edge 32a of the fixed cutting tool 32 is provided with a clearance angle downward so that the cutting edge 30a does not hit after the cutting edge 30a of the moving cutting tool 30 hits and cuts. For example, it is preferable to provide a clearance angle of about 10 °.
- the moving blade 30 is arranged in the horizontal direction so that the cutting start side (the left side in FIG. 1) of the cutting edge 30 a is closer to the fixed blade 32 than the cutting end side (the right side in FIG. 1).
- the fixed blade 32 is fixed to the movable blade fixing portion 34 while being inclined by an angle ⁇ with respect to the blade edge 32a.
- the movable blade 30 is attached to the movable base 36 by being inclined by an angle ⁇ with respect to the vertical direction so that the blade edge 30 a is pressed against the blade edge 32 a of the fixed blade 32.
- the movable blade 30 is fixed to the fixed blade 32 by the elastic force generated by the bending along the short side direction of the movable blade 30 itself. Pressed against the cutting edge 32a.
- a guide 30b for the cutting edge 32a of the fixed cutting tool 32 on the cutting start side (left side in FIG. 1) of the cutting edge 30a of the moving cutting tool 30.
- the guide 30b is a plate-like protrusion that protrudes from the moving blade 30 toward the fixed blade 32.
- the guide 30b is in contact with the cutting edge 32a of the fixed blade 32 even when the moving base 36 is maximally separated from the fixed blade 32. It is provided to maintain.
- the guide 30b may be provided on the fixed blade 32 side.
- the lower diagram in FIG. 3 is a view of the movable blade 30 and the fixed blade 32 as viewed from the front, and the upper diagram in FIG. 3 shows the contact state between the movable blade 30 and the fixed blade 32 along the lines BB, CC, and DD.
- FIG. FIG. 3 shows a state in which shearing starts from the cutting start side of the cutting edge 30a of the moving blade 30 and proceeds to the line DD.
- the moving blade 30 In the line DD, the moving blade 30 is bent by ⁇ in the short side direction and the cutting edge 30a is pressed against and contacted with the cutting edge 32a of the fixed blade 32. In the line CC, the bending of the moving blade 30 is almost eliminated. In line BB, the movable blade 30 and the fixed blade 32 are not in contact with each other. Between the line CC and the line DD, the moving blade 30 is in pressure contact with the fixed blade 32, but the amount of deflection is greatest at the shear point of the line DD. Thus, the contact pressure between the cutting edge 30a of the moving blade 30 and the cutting edge 32a of the fixed blade 32 is maximized at the portion where the sheet-like member W is sheared, and a strong shearing force can be obtained.
- the fixed cutter 32 is laid down in the horizontal direction.
- the fixed cutter 32 may be arranged in the vertical direction. Good.
- the moving blade 30 and the fixed blade 32 may be brought into contact with each other by using the elastic force in the short side direction of the moving blade 30 itself.
- the movable blade 30 is an elastic member, but the fixed blade 32 may be an elastic member.
- the moving blade itself is not pressed against the fixed blade by an elastic member such as a spring or a leaf spring, but is pressed against the fixed blade using the elastic force of the moving blade itself.
- an elastic member such as a spring or a leaf spring
- the number of members constituting the apparatus can be reduced, and the manufacturing cost of the apparatus can be reduced.
- the work process at the time of exchanging a movable knife can be simplified, and maintenance, inspection, etc. become easier.
